Donghae is a city in Gangwon Province, South Korea. There are two major ports: Donghae Harbor and Mukho Harbor. The city is located on the Yeongdong Line railroad and the Donghae Expressway.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Mukho station is a railway station in Donghae City in Gangwon Province, South Korea. Mukho station is on the Yeongdong Line, and the Mukhohang Line.

Mukho is a harbor in Donghae City, Gangwon Province, South Korea. It is located on the shore of the East Sea. In the past it played an important role in the shipping of iron ore and coal; much of this role has been taken over by Donghae Harbor in recent years.
